#b4c2de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b4c2de is composed of 70.6% red, 76.1%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.9% cyan, 12.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 220 degrees, a saturation of 38.9% and a lightness of 78.8%. #b4c2de color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6985bd.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#b4c2de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b4c2de has RGB values of R:180, G:194,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0.19, M:0.13,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 11846366.
